Output 74f3fa3bc08c55a1431817c1ef3bc005c10eeb0e71a5f6f173479f3dce2667e1:0

value
168036247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db6e862aef9238a55f91780db296d2a74c68e5fb OP_EQUAL
address
3MhGJuLd1CkAoSm7MsG75baQBUGwAPTXhK
transaction
74f3fa3bc08c55a1431817c1ef3bc005c10eeb0e71a5f6f173479f3dce2667e1
spent
true